addMagicWordsByLang() -- always include english in the fallback chain
authorTim Starling <tstarling@users.mediawiki.org>
Thu, 6 Sep 2007 00:21:49 +0000 (00:21 +0000)
committerTim Starling <tstarling@users.mediawiki.org>
Thu, 6 Sep 2007 00:21:49 +0000 (00:21 +0000)
languages/Language.php

index 3f9d98f..439856b 100644 (file)
@@ -1163,6 +1163,9 @@ class Language {
                        $fallbackChain[] = $code;
                        $code = self::getFallbackFor( $code );
                }
+               if ( !in_array( 'en', $fallbackChain ) ) {
+                       $fallbackChain[] = 'en';
+               }
                $fallbackChain = array_reverse( $fallbackChain );
                foreach ( $fallbackChain as $code ) {
                        if ( isset( $newWords[$code] ) ) {